ingredients
- 236.59 236.59 ml monterey jack pepper cheese or 236.59 ml cheddar cheese
- 1 green onion
- 14.79-44.37 ml canned chopped chile (to taste)
- 4 8-inch flour tortillas
- chunky salsa, for topping or dipping
directions
- In a medium bowl, toss together the cheese, green onion, and chilies: set aside.
- Spray a medium skillet with nonstick spray and place over medium heat.
- When hot, add 1 tortilla and sprinkle it with one-fourth of the cheese mixture.
- When the cheese begins to melt, about 1 minute, fold in half.
- Continue cooking until lightly brown on both sides, about 1 minute.
- Transfer to cutting board, Repeat with the remaining tortillas and filling.
- Cut into wedges with a knife or pizza cutter and serve immediately with salsa.
